How to Calibrate, Verify, Clean & Maintain the A&D SJ-5000HS

A&D SJ-5000HS calibration uses an external reference, while daily reliability depends on stable installation, correct pan seating, adequate battery voltage and routine known-weight verification. Treat calibration as an adjustment procedure—not as the first response to every changing reading.

Prepare the scale

Set the scale on a rigid level surface, away from drafts and vibration. Install the clean dry pan and verify that it does not rub the housing. Let the unit and reference mass stabilize to room conditions. Confirm zero and wait for a stable indication before starting calibration or verification.

External calibration

Follow the manufacturer calibration sequence with an appropriate calibrated reference mass. Center the mass and place it gently. When the procedure completes, remove it, confirm zero and test an independent known weight. A calibration routine that finishes successfully is not proof that the scale meets every application tolerance; verification must compare actual error with the process requirement.

Verification and repeatability

Place the same known weight several times, removing it completely between readings. Results should return consistently within the tolerance established by the user’s procedure. Test a working-range value relevant to normal portions or packages. If results vary, inspect the bench, container, pan and environment before changing calibration. Product movement and warm or evaporating samples can also shift readings.

Cleaning the pan and housing

Remove and clean the SUS304 pan separately using compatible methods. Wipe the housing with a lightly damp cloth and keep liquid away from controls and the battery compartment. Dry fully and inspect the pan support for crumbs or residue. Reinstall the pan, check zero and verify a known weight before returning to production.

Battery maintenance

Use four matched D cells and replace the full set together. Observe polarity and remove batteries for extended storage. If operation becomes intermittent, compare performance on fresh batteries and the correct AC adapter. Battery problems can mimic scale faults, especially when the unit shuts down or resets under load.

Troubleshooting common problems

Unstable readings often come from vibration, airflow, temperature changes or a container touching another surface. Poor zero return can result from debris or pan binding. A repeatable error against known masses may require calibration or service. A load that exceeds 5 kg gross must be removed immediately. Pressing tare only changes the displayed reference; it does not increase load-cell capacity.

Frequently asked questions

Is calibration external? Yes. Should I calibrate after every cleaning? Verify first; calibrate only when results justify it. Can the housing be immersed? No. Why does a large bowl read low? It may touch the bench or housing. What causes poor zero return? Residue, pan contact, an unstable surface or a remaining load. Should all batteries be replaced together? Yes. Does tare prevent overload? No. What should be documented? Reference identity, as-found result, any adjustment and as-left verification when the quality system requires it.
